Power Yoga Canada Seeks to Empower Communities Through Wellness

The wholesome motto of Power Yoga Canada is quite simple and straightforward — to "empower communities into action." The company attempts to do so through skilled staff, extensive workshops, and mindful exercise.

The business model exudes tolerance and support through community values. The mat is the "space to breakdown and breakthrough." The classes are open to all skill levels and the workout is heated to promote the best possible experience. Interactions with trainers and other participants are strongly encouraged by Power Yoga Canada, offering a platform for individuals with similar interests to thrive together.

In addition, the institution boasts a mobile application that allows guests to check out the schedule, reserve spots, purchase passes, and more.
